How to set Algo 8180 as Ringer

Updated: 09/30/2025

Problem

Algo 8180 functions as a pager, and not a ringer.
When the customer wants to use the Algo extension in a Ring Group, so it can alert by ringing over the speakers instead of paging. 

Solution

The Algo needs to be activated using SIP Credentials.
How to factory reset the Algo:
  • If the Algo has already been activated using the Provisioning URL, then factory reset the device by navigating to the System tab and selecting the Maintenance tab. 
  • In the Backup/Restore Configuration section, select the Restore Defaults button.

  • Select OK when prompted.

  • Select the Reboot button when prompted. After a few minutes, the device will come back online in its factory default state, including the default password: algo.

Algo Setup with SIP Authentication:

Log into the Algo and set the following for SIP registration (FOR SIP Integration only):
  • Auth name = GUN/Username
  • Page Extension = GUN/Username
  • Auth Password = SIP Password
  • URL = unsbc.8x8.com:5299
  • Set as NON-SRTP

SIP Registration:

  1. Navigate to the Control Panel.
  2. Click Basic Settings > SIP.

  3. Enter the GUN into the Auth name and Extension.
  4. Enter the SIP Password into the Auth Password.
  5. Enter unsbc.8x8.com:5299 into SIP Domain.

Finally, check the device status page, and it should show as Ring #1 Successful.

Reason

The Algo will only function as a pager when activated using our Provisioning URL.
